There are some community matters to take care of before the fence appears in the back garden. It's natural to presume that if you want a fence then you just get one, but it's really a good idea to just let your neighbors know and of course it depends on what kind of fence you're getting. This is really easy to check on, and you can even find out probably online regarding zoning requirements and permits for this and that. There really are no laws, to my knowledge, that states you can't have a fence if the neighbor objects, but it's a nice gesture.
